金融云存储应该具有哪些特性?

参与8

2同行回答

baimmibaimmi系统架构师中国银联股份有限公司
金融云存储由于受到行业监管机构的要求,为了满足国家等保的要求,大部分是面向数据中心私有云场景,实现大规模、大容量的存储资源池,整合替代现有存储设施,支撑各类OLTP或OLAP业务应用。为了能够对各类决策支撑系统、研发测试系统提供有效支撑;突破随机访问海量数据的性能瓶颈;解...显示全部

金融云存储由于受到行业监管机构的要求,为了满足国家等保的要求,大部分是面向数据中心私有云场景,实现大规模、大容量的存储资源池,整合替代现有存储设施,支撑各类OLTP或OLAP业务应用。为了能够对各类决策支撑系统、研发测试系统提供有效支撑;突破随机访问海量数据的性能瓶颈;解决数据安全性、存储平滑扩容等问题。具体上总结下来具有以下几点特性:
1、高性能:
金融云存储系统提供了类似于条带化一样的并行I/O功能,提供能够支持业务开展的高性能;
支持各类接口闪存介质如NVMe等,通过闪存介质的使用,来提供高性能的IO。
2、高可靠性:
存储系统内部通过提供多副本、纠删码、奇偶校验码等手段提供数据的可靠性;硬件上通过硬件HA提供硬件的高可靠;私有云场景下OpenSTack的管理组件如Cinder等,也应该遵循高可用。
数据的一致性在金融场景下应该采用严格的强一致性,保证租户成功写入一份数据时,几个副本都保持一致,在读取数据时,无论从任何一个副本上进行,都能够保证取到最新的、可用的数据。
金融云存储下一代云存储系统提供了多种场景下的服务质量保证手段:提供面向卷级的服务器访问QoS,充分避免非关键应用占用过多带宽;在数据较长时间处于不一致的状态时,自动触发数据重建,在此过程中支持QoS,保证重建过程中占用过多带宽,避免影响关键业务的稳定运行。
金融云存储系统中,为保证系统达到预期的可靠性目标,必须在保证高并发的前提下,尽量缩小副本分布的磁盘范围,即设定安全边界,以防止数据丢失的风险陡然上升。
3、可扩展性:
金融云存储系统支持大规模扩展,最低三节点,直至上千节点,随着存储设备数量的增长,整个系统的吞吐量和IOPS等性能指标也同时会随之增长。并且容量和性能呈线性扩展。
4、易管理性:
金融云存储应该在接口上兼容VMware体系的SOAP标准,而面向OpenStack的接口则遵循REST标准;
5、诸多高级功能:
为了简便使用过程,金融云存储系统也应该具有如实时快照、精简配置和数据重建负载均衡等高级功能,不在此一一赘述。

收起
银行 · 2017-11-20
浏览1373
weiliang1216weiliang1216it技术咨询顾问IBM
这个问题范围有点大,我从我的理解角度答一下首先要看这朵云存储的是什么东西?核心系统,边缘系统还是开发测试环境,我一般不建议把这几类放在一朵云上核心系统一般变动频率较低,业务牵连广,因此首要考虑安全,稳定,保持性能。需要强业务连续性,容灾性,高性能。边缘系统变动频率就略高...显示全部

这个问题范围有点大,我从我的理解角度答一下
首先要看这朵云存储的是什么东西?
核心系统,边缘系统还是开发测试环境,我一般不建议把这几类放在一朵云上
核心系统一般变动频率较低,业务牵连广,因此首要考虑安全,稳定,保持性能。
需要强业务连续性,容灾性,高性能。
边缘系统变动频率就略高了,但可能数量较多
因此可管理性,扩展能力,部署的简易性,以及性价比更为重要。
而开发测试系统则一般更加看重敏捷性,并且相对的需要融入跟多的最新科技元素,结构也经常变
因此除了边缘系统类似的特性以外,可能还需要一些快速备份与恢复的功能。

收起
IT咨询服务 · 2017-11-20
浏览1153

提问者

冯连进
技术经理picc
擅长领域: 大数据大数据平台数据库

问题来自

问题状态

  • 发布时间:2017-11-20
  • 关注会员:3 人
  • 问题浏览:3885
  • 最近回答:2017-11-20
  • X社区推广